diaphragm in Chinese
diaphragm in Chinese is 橫膈膜, 横膈膜 — diaphragm means the dome-shaped muscle beneath the lungs that controls breathing.

What does "diaphragm" mean?
-
noun The dome-shaped muscle beneath the lungs that controls breathing.
"Singers are taught to breathe from the diaphragm for better control."
-
noun A dome-shaped contraceptive device inserted to cover the cervix.
"She was fitted for a diaphragm at her doctor's appointment."
-
noun A thin, flexible membrane, such as the vibrating part of a speaker or microphone.
"The speaker's diaphragm vibrates to produce sound waves."
